The inauguration of Prime Minister Kim Min-seok and the significance of a Sejong-centered governance operation.

The inauguration date of Prime Minister Kim Min-seok, July 7, 2025, is expected to become an important milestone in the country's governance and regional balanced development. The issue of concentration in the metropolitan area has been a serious problem that Korean society has faced for a long time. As population, resources, and industries have concentrated in Seoul and surrounding areas, the imbalance between regions has deepened. While the provinces have become 'margins of opportunity,' the overcrowded Seoul is suffering from housing, transportation, and environmental issues. These problems extend beyond mere spatial issues, adversely affecting social conflicts, intergenerational inequalities, and future sustainability. Therefore, Prime Minister Kim Min-seok's inauguration will serve as an important starting point for restructuring the governance space and implementing regional balanced development strategies.

Philosophy of State Governance and the Language of Mission: The Prime Minister's Will Revealed in the Inaugural Address

Prime Minister Kim Min-seok's inaugural speech carries a profound weight that goes beyond mere rhetorical sentences. The speech begins with the phrase, "I would like to thank the citizens who opened a new era and the President who entrusted me with this role," emphasizing a sense of communal responsibility. In particular, the expression "Youth was a sense of indignation, and life was full of twists and turns, but it was a blessing" reveals his intention to deeply reflect on the weight of his position as both a human being and an administrator, moving beyond political rhetoric. He has clearly stated his resolve to address issues swiftly while taking on the role of 'Director of the National Comprehensive Situation Headquarters' and 'Dawn Prime Minister.' Additionally, he mentioned his commitment to paying attention to people's suffering, transcending political colors, and presenting the philosophy that innovation begins not merely with institutional improvements but with changes in individuals.

The place called Sejong: A spatial transition in national governance

The inauguration of Prime Minister Kim Min-seok at the Sejong Government Complex is interpreted not merely as a political event, but as the beginning of structural change. While Sejong City was designed as an administrative-centered complex city, the actual operations of national governance have still been concentrated in Seoul. By holding this important event in Sejong, it sends a strong message that the focus of governance will genuinely shift. President Lee Jae-myung's directive for a permanent presence in Sejong further deepens this commitment to change, emphasizing that Sejong's role as an administrative capital must be substantial. Additionally, the fact that key events such as cabinet meetings and high-level meetings will take place in Sejong can be seen as the first practical move towards a political transition.

Prime Minister's Actions Translated into Practice: Realization of Administrative Centering in Sejong

Prime Minister Kim Min-seok is demonstrating his governance philosophy through action rather than specific announcements. He has personally visited major institutions in Sejong both before and after taking office to inspect current issues, and in particular, he is showing his commitment to share the hardships of the field by visiting the disaster safety situation room and construction sites responding to heat waves. Additionally, he has expressed his determination to transform Sejong into a 'platform for active governance' by examining projects including the presidential office candidate site and the National Assembly site. This approach can be interpreted as a signal that not only reflects the integrity of the Prime Minister himself but also indicates that the entire government system is seeking administrative structural changes. It is a concrete measure to decentralize the heart and brain of governance from Seoul.

Structural Change and Policy Design: Ensuring the Effectiveness of Regional Balanced Development

The Prime Minister Kim Min-seok's governance centered in Sejong provides an opportunity to strengthen the strategy for balanced regional development. While past local policies mainly focused on providing physical infrastructure and relocating public institutions, now the core of national planning, budgeting, and legal system design must actually exist in the regions. With the Prime Minister's Office residing in Sejong, a change will occur where regions are not merely considered as targets for support, but as active participants in governance. This change will not be limited to the city of Sejong true balanced regional development will be realized when the Sejong model spreads to regions across the country. This will pave the way to overcome the capital-centric approach and enhance the country's dimensionality.
